java中如何对类定义方法

java中如何对类定义方法

作者:Joshua Lee发布时间:2026-02-27阅读时长:0 分钟阅读次数:9

用户关注问题

Q
Java中定义类的方法需要注意哪些语法规则?

在Java中,当我想为类添加一个方法时,应该遵循哪些语法规则?例如,方法的修饰符、返回类型和参数等方面需要注意什么?

A

Java类方法的基本语法结构

在Java中定义类的方法时,需要指定方法的修饰符(如public、private)、返回类型(void表示无返回值,或具体的数据类型)、方法名以及参数列表。方法体必须用大括号包围,里面包含执行的代码。方法名一般遵循驼峰命名法,参数如果有,类型和变量名都要明确。

Q
如何在Java类中实现一个带参数且有返回值的方法?

我想在Java类中写一个方法,这个方法需要接受参数并返回结果,应该如何定义和使用?

A

定义和使用带参数带返回值的方法

在Java类中,可通过在方法声明中指定参数类型和名称来接受参数,同时指定返回类型来表示返回数据的类型。方法内部可以使用参数进行运算,最后使用return语句返回结果。调用该方法时需要传入对应类型的参数,并可获取返回值使用。

Q
Java中类方法与实例方法有什么区别?

定义的方法时,如果加上static关键字,会和普通类方法有什么不同?

A

静态方法与实例方法的区别

带有static关键字的方法称为静态方法,它属于类本身,可以通过类名直接调用,无需创建对象。而实例方法属于类的对象,必须先实例化对象后才能调用。静态方法不能访问实例变量和实例方法,但实例方法可以访问静态成员。